New Federal Contractors — April 09, 2026

New Federal Contractors

12 total filings analysed

Executive Summary

This digest covers 12 new federal contractor awards totaling $1,755,742,802 in obligations from April 9, 2026, with only 1/12 defense-related (CACI's GSA network defense IT contract) and the rest civilian-focused across GSA, VA, NASA, DHS, Treasury, Commerce, and State. Dominant themes include IT systems design and network support, led by GSA and VA with multi-year delivery orders emphasizing cybersecurity and cloud migration. Highest-conviction bullish signal is CACI, Inc. - Federal's $708M cost-plus award for federal enterprise network defense, signaling low-risk revenue through 2024 despite negative outlays to date. Key risk is execution uncertainty from $0 outlays on recent awards like Brasfield & Gorrie LLC's $95.5M DHS construction (starts 2026) and Integral Federal's $61M State printing equipment contract.

Investment Signals(6)

  • CACI Secures $708M GSA IT Network Defense Delivery Order(HIGH)

    CACI, Inc. - Federal won a $708,253,079 cost-plus award fee delivery order (potential $1.03B with options) under full competition for federal enterprise network defense IT systems (NAICS 541512), providing low-risk ~$141M annual revenue through 2024-04-30 despite negative $-453K outlays.

  • Deloitte Consulting Wins $121M GSA Ginnie Mae Cloud Migration(MEDIUM)

    Deloitte Consulting LLP secured a $121,868,141 time-and-materials delivery order (potential $205M with options) for IT cybersecurity and cloud services (NAICS 541512, PSC D310), supporting long-term federal cloud needs through potential 2030 extension.

  • Brasfield & Gorrie Lands $95.5M DHS Coast Guard Base Construction(MEDIUM)

    Brasfield & Gorrie LLC received a $95,538,222 firm fixed-price delivery order under full competition for USCG Base Charleston utility infrastructure and clinic construction, offering ~$29M annual revenue from 2026-04-20 to 2029-07-10.

  • Deloitte Consulting Captures $80.3M Treasury Intelligence Analysis BPA Call(HIGH)

    Deloitte Consulting LLP won an $80,346,773 firm fixed-price BPA call (potential $101M) under full competition for administrative management consulting (NAICS 541611, PSC B538), with $62.6M already outlayed since 2022.

  • Integral Federal Wins $61M State Passport Printer Delivery Order(MEDIUM)

    Integral Federal, Inc. secured a $61,037,138 firm fixed-price delivery order under full competition for next-generation passport printing equipment (NAICS 333244), projecting ~$25M annual revenue through June 2026.

  • Salient CRGT Faces High Pricing Risk on $205M VA Network Support(MEDIUM)

    Salient CRGT, Inc.'s $205,535,562 firm fixed-price VA delivery order (NAICS 541512) carries high contract risk despite $101M outlayed, with subawards exceeding obligation at $269M across 43 awards.
